Crispy Bacon and Avocado Salad

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 6 Minutes
Ready In: 11 Minutes
Servings: 4

Ingredients:
1 large crisp lettuce
8 slices lean bacon
1 large ripe avocado
1/2 cucumber
1 eating apple
1 tablespoon chopped parsley
1 teaspoon br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on mustard powder
salt and pepper
4 tablespoons oil
1 tablespoon vinegar
1 tablespoon lemon juice
Directions:
1. Make a French Dressing. Put the vinegar, oil, lemon juice, mustard and brown sugar into the jar. Season with the salt and pepper.
2. Screw the lid of the jar on tightly and shake the contents well for a minute. Pour into a jug ready to serve.
3. Wash and dry the lettuce. Shred it and put it into the bowl.
4. Chop up the cucumber and apple. Peel the avocado and cut the flesh into medium-sized chunks. Mix with the lettuce.
5. Cut the rind off the bacon rashers and grill under a low to medium heat for about 6 minutes, turning occasionally.
6. Allow to drain on kitchen towel.
7. Slice the warm bacon into small pieces. Gently mix the pieces into the salad. Sprinkle with parsley.
8. Serve while the bacon is still warm with the jug of French dressing.
